Bouchon Santa Barbara
Nestled in a quiet side street of State Street, Bouchon ( French for wine cork) combines fresh, local ingredients with a French and Californian twist. With a relaxing, understated ambiance, Bouchon offers pepper-crusted venison, warm sweet onion & blue cheese tart and much more for the food enthusiast. An excellent wine list featuring wines from the Santa Barbara area also awaits you at Bouchon. Be sure to take a peek inside the private dining area--the entire ceiling is made from wine corks, of course.

The Stonehouse
The famous San Ysidro Ranch's The Stonehouse offers gourmet dishes made with regional ingredients and produce grown from its on-site garden. In a rustic country house setting with stone walls, this restaurant was formerly a 19th century citrus packing house. Chef John Trotta offers Maine lobster, roasted rack of lamb, and carnaroli risotto in the restaurant that Diner's Choice named as one of the top 50 restaurants in the United States and the hotel that Forbes Traveler calls America's Best Hotel.

China Pavilion
High-quality Chinese food with a gourmet touch is found at China Pavilion. The friendly staff, casual atmosphere and great food make for a wonderful experience. Choose from the spicy Kung Pao chicken or succulent jasmine tea smoked duck among other Chinese classics. The lunch menu includes soup and salad with every lunch entree. Chinese Pavilion is one of the few Chinese restaurants in the area using certified angus beef.

Tupelo Junction Cafe
The funky Tupelo Junction Cafe is perfect for a down home lunch or dinner. With everything made from scratch, Tupelo Junction serves classic dishes from the deep South with a California flair. Warm up your appetite with the Maine lobster, potato & sweet corn chowder and the fried green tomatoes. Save room for its famous chocolate turtle beignets w/ crème anglaise & candied pecans. It's no wonder this popular local restaurant is nearly always packed, so make sure you place a reservation before you go. The cafe serves breakfast, lunch and dinner.
